Trading results
The robot was tested on the USDCAD cross pair on H1. The data period has united 2010-2021 years. The modeling quality was 99.90% with a 10-pip spread. An initial deposit was $10,000 and it has become $7,380 of the total net profit. The profit factor was 1.80. The maximum drawdown was 9.02%. Forex Trend Hunter has closed 534 deals with the accuracy rate of 79% for short and 53% for long trading positions.
Verified trading results always increase a level of trust to an introduced system. Alas, it’s only a demo account. The robot has been running on IC Markets automatically with 1:500 leverage on the MT4 platform. The account was created on February 10, 2020, and deposited at $10,000. Since then, the absolute gain has become 21.32%. An average monthly gain is 0.93%. It’s not enough profitability for the expert advisor.
The robot has traded 102 orders with 983.3 pips. An average win is 28.11 pips when an average loss is -34.68 pips. The profit factor is 2.68.
The advisor executes three times more trades in the Longs direction (77 deals).
The advisor opens most of the trade during the European trading session.
The system doesn’t trade much on Mondays and Tuesdays.
The account is run with medium risks. The system has to lose 28 orders in a row to lose 10% of the account.
We may note that martingale doesn’t always bring success.
We should note that the last two months were unprofitable for this trading account.
